Transaction 338c28d5a0b1148407846e9b4f5b513af4e87e39920f90182bb6444a39879bf5

block
4da723e9b6497089afdfa8168ab34642685c86d050185d5a6531cfba0f8bfe59

1 Input

23 Outputs